Economic uncertainty and rising costs have pushed many Americans to seek smarter, low-barrier transportation solutions. A key driver behind growing interest is the declining role of credit cards as the sole gateway to car rentals—historically required for deposits and insurance. As consumer trust shifts toward online trust signals and verified platform reputations, rental services are adapting to demand for frictionless access.

Services verify identity and rental history through secure digital channels, often embedding payment checks within act}{(confidence-building processes) that don’t require card access. Many platforms use buyer protections, insurance wallet cards, or third-party payment gateways to secure deposits temporarily—allowing users to drive while mitigating risk.
Monitoring trips and payments through secure apps gives drivers peace of mind. Some services even offer zero-deposit test drives or demo days that let users experience vehicles before committing. This system replaces traditional credit screening with real-time reputation data and verified transaction records.
